O Ubuntu irá suspender, mas não irá acordar

9

Eu instalei o Ubuntu 12.10 em um Apple MacBook Pro 9,1 meados de 2012 de 15 polegadas sem retina. Suspender suspende mas quando eu abro a tampa, ela não acorda. Eu tentei pressionar Ctrl + Alt + F1, mas nada funciona. Apenas a luz de fundo do teclado é ativada. Qual é o problema?

Além disso, estou usando o driver X org nouveau e não o oficial nVidia. Por favor ajude. É irritante desligar o laptop toda vez.

    
por pratnala 28.10.2012 / 18:34

3 respostas

0

No Ubuntu 13.04 e acima, dormir e acordar funcionam perfeitamente quando você instala os drivers da NVIDIA. Eles não funcionam nos drivers nouveau .

    
por pratnala 04.11.2013 / 05:31
2

De preferência, tente consertar sua função de hibernação se ela não funcionar também. porque em casos semelhantes com "problema de sono", parece que a hibernação é uma solução mais prática e viável. Fale com este post

  • Teste pci = noacpi como um parâmetro de inicialização
  • dê uma olhada no / etc / default / acpi-support , provavelmente ele precisa de algumas alterações
  • e se tiver sorte, este comando pode ajudá-lo:

    sudo chmod + x /etc/pm/sleep.d / *

apesar de tudo, parece que esse tipo de problema está relacionado a uma coisa de hardware (incompatibilidade do driver gráfico ou Power Manager) então por que você não experimenta o driver NVidia apropriado para a sua distribuição de SO?

    
por Amir Reza Adib 14.11.2012 / 16:17
0

Se você tem um CD ao vivo, tente usá-lo e a ferramenta de reparo de inicialização. Parece que não há nada errado com o grub, mas é uma boa idéia alterar algumas opções de inicialização. Estas são algumas opções úteis mencionadas pelo próprio canonico.

  • vga = xxx

Defina a resolução do seu framebuffer para o modo VESA xxx. Confira aqui uma lista de possíveis modos.

  • acpi = off OU noacpi

Este parâmetro desabilita todo o sistema ACPI. Isso pode ser muito útil, por exemplo, se o seu computador não oferecer suporte a ACPI ou se você achar que a implementação da ACPI pode causar alguns problemas (por exemplo, reinicializações aleatórias ou travamentos do sistema).

  • acpi = force

Ativa o sistema ACPI mesmo que a data do BIOS do computador seja anterior a 2000. Esse parâmetro substitui acpi = off e também pode ser usado com o hardware atual se o suporte a ACPI não estiver ativado apesar de apm = off.

  • pci = noacpi OU acpi = noirq

Estes parâmetros desabilitam o roteamento PCI IRQ

  • pci = acpi

Este parâmetro ativa o roteamento PCI IRQ

  • acpi_irq_balance

A ACPI pode usar interrupções PIC para minimizar o uso comum de IRQs.

  • acpi_irq_nobalance

A ACPI não tem permissão para usar interrupções PIC.

  • acpi = oldboot

Desativa quase completamente o sistema ACPI; somente os componentes necessários para o processo de inicialização serão usados.

  • acpi = ht

Desativa quase completamente o sistema ACPI; somente os componentes necessários para o hyper-threading serão usados.

  • noapic

Desabilite o "APIC (Advanced Programmable Interrupt Controller)".

  • nolapic

Desative a "APIC local".

  • apm = off OU noapm

Desativar o gerenciamento avançado de energia.

  • irqpoll

Altera a maneira como o kernel lida com as chamadas interrompidas (configure-o para polling). Pode ser útil em caso de problemas de interrupção de hardware.

  • acpi.power_nocheck = 1 OU acpi_osi = linux

Desative a verificação do estado de energia ou altere a compatibilidade do sistema operacional relatada ao BIOS. Necessário em alguns BIOSes quebrados para fazer o controle de temperatura / ventilador funcionar.

consulte este link

    
por Amir Reza Adib 19.03.2013 / 12:47